摘要:本文全面分析 TPWallet 资金池中代币(通常称为 LP 代币)的计算方法,并重点探讨个性化支付选项、合约同步、专家咨询报告、交易成功判定、代币发行机制和手续费率设计等要点,给出公式、示例与风险提示。
一、LP 代币基础计算方法
- 基本原理:LP 代币代表流动性提供者在池中所占份额。常见公式(在无手续费、无时间权重情况下):

新增铸造量 = 总发行量 × (提供资产价值 / 池中总资产价值)
若总发行量为 0(初始建池),可按 sqrt(x*y) 或直接以提供的资产价值作为初始供应量。
- 单资产加入:若只用一种资产加入,合约通常按当前池比例或使用定价公式(如恒定乘积)计算等值,并可能收取兑换差额。
- 退出(燃烧):燃烧的 LP 代币对应按份额提取池中对应比例的所有资产。
示例:池中资产 A=1000, B=2000,LP 总量=100。用户追加 A=100, 等值 B=200(保持比例),新增 LP = 100 × (100/(1000)) = 10。

二、个性化支付选项
- 多币种入金:支持多种计价货币(例如稳定币、ETH、CNT),合约需在入金时做汇率折算;建议使用链上价格预言机并设滑点保护。
- 分期与分层费用:允许用户选择一次性或分期入金、VIP 费率(较低手续费)、按期限锁定获得额外奖励。
- UX 与安全:前端应展示预估铸币量、滑点、手续费明细,并要求用户确认交易参数。
三、合约同步(跨模块/跨链)
- 状态同步:若 TPWallet 涉及多合约或跨链桥,必须保证事件(Mint/Burn/Swap)的一致性。可采用事件总线、Merkle 证明或轻节点验证。
- 幂等与重试:设计幂等接口,避免重复执行铸币或转账;引入 nonce、唯一 TX ID 和回滚策略。
- 审计与监控:实时监听链上事件,异常时触发告警并在 UI 提示用户可能的延迟。
四、专家咨询报告应包含的要点
- 假设与建模:说明价格模型、流动性深度、波动率假设及手续费模型。
- 场景分析:常态、极端波动、前端攻击(夹层交易、闪电贷)等影响 LP 价值的情形。
- 风险量化:impermanent loss 估算、清算风险、合约漏洞风险评级。
- 建议措施:手续费调整策略、奖励激励、合约升级路径与多重签名治理建议。
五、交易成功的判定与用户体验
- 成功条件:交易在链上达到指定 confirmations 且事件(Mint/Burn/Transfer)被合约记录。
- 失败与回滚:若因 gas 不足或合约校验失败,应返回失败原因并确保资金回退或提示后续处理步骤。
- 提示信息:显示交易哈希、预计确认时间、实际已确认块数及可能的下一步操作(如重试或联系客服)。
六、代币发行与治理设计
- 初始铸造:明确初始 LP 供应计算方法与初始提供者的激励(锁仓奖励、团队份额需透明)。
- 通货膨胀/通缩:若协议设计奖励通胀代币,应说明发行节奏、减半/衰减机制与治理投票权关系。
- 代币分配:列出流动性激励、团队、社区、基金会比例及锁定期,防止短期稀释。
七、手续费率设计(Fee Rate)
- 固定费率 vs 动态费率:固定如 0.3% 适合稳定场景;动态按波动/深度调整可提升整体收益并抑制损失。
- 费用分配:常见分配为 LP(大部分)、协议金库、回购与燃烧、推荐奖励。示例:LP 费得 0.25%,协议金库 0.05%。
- 激励兼容性:降低长期 LP 的实际手续费成本可通过分红、代币空投或收益农场实现。
八、实务建议与风险提示
- 在前端和合约中显示清晰的入金/铸币公式、预期 LP 份额与手续费明细。
- 定期聘请第三方审计并发布专家咨询报告,结合链上监控和应急治理流程。
- 对跨链或跨合约同步采用可证明的消息传递机制,避免状态不一致导致的财产损失。
结论:TPWallet 的资金池代币计算在数学上并不复杂,但在实际产品化过程中涉及价格预言机、跨合约同步、个性化支付、手续费设计与治理等多维度要素。结合明确的公式、透明的代币发行方案与可靠的合约同步与监控,能显著提升用户信任与交易成功率。
评论
SkyWalker
很实用的总结,尤其是合约同步和手续费分配部分很到位。
小明
示例清晰,帮我理解了 LP 代币的铸造流程,期待后续关于跨链桥的深挖。
CryptoFan88
建议在手续费动态调整里加上具体算法样例,会更好落地。
林夕
专家咨询报告结构非常实用,能直接用作内部审计清单。